Péco formed in Fortaleza, Ceará around 2010, with Alex Moreira on vocals, Thiago Mendonça on guitar, Rafael Oliveira on bass, and André Freitas on drums. They started playing on the streets with limited resources.
Their 2013 song "Péco Fortificado" became a breakthrough hit in Brazil. The track's music video gathered millions of views, and the band followed it with other songs like "Péco Maloqueiro" and "Preto Branco." They released live albums and worked with artists including Gabriel Diniz and Mano Walter.
Some of Péco's lyrics drew criticism for their content, though the band maintained they were reflecting social realities. Their music often dealt with themes of strength and cultural identity that connected with Brazilian listeners.
